Every sheet of THP paper passes through the same quiet step: drying. For decades, that meant laying paper out under open sky and waiting on the weather.
This year, we introduced an electric dryer to work alongside our traditional sun-drying process - not to replace it, but to keep production steady when the weather doesn't cooperate.
The result: faster turnaround, fewer delays, and the same handmade quality our artisans have always delivered.

The story of handmade paper begins long before the final product reaches your hands. At THP, women are involved in every stage of the process - from dyeing and drying paper sheets to sewing journals, crafting envelopes, making lampshades, preparing incense packaging, and creating decorative products that carry Nepalese craftsmanship to the world. Each product represents more than skill. It represents employment, independence, creativity, and the preservation of traditional knowledge.
